Общие вопросы
Понимание portage и параметров emerge
user108 17 июля, 2013 - 14:39Несколько дней назад поставили даный дистрибутив и вот начал знакомиться с portage и утилитой emerge. Читал хэндбук и маны, но некоторые вопросы есть, а именно детального понимания. Вот, например, в emerge есть параметр --deep, я так понимаю, что при использовании emerge --update без даного параметра мы можем обновить пакет или world, но emerge проверит только версию пакета, но ни его зависимости. В хэндбуке: написано "Portage не будет тщательно проверять их зависимости", как это понять, значит какие-то зависимости он проверяет?
Удаление текста с файла [Solved]
fame 17 июля, 2013 - 05:18Такой вот небольшой вопрос, помогите пожалуйста разобраться :)
Если запусь в файл мы делаем через echo, т.е. echo -en "text" >> test.txt
И как же теперь сделать что бы оно нашло слово "text" и удалило его в файле test?
Количество пакетов в репозитарии. [РЕШЕНО]
Yuri01 16 июля, 2013 - 19:24Д.день.
Скажите, где я могу увидеть статистику репозитария пакетов (общее число пакетов, число пакетов с разбивкой по категориям и пр.).
Зарание спасибо.
Установленный Redmine не виден с удаленных машин.[РЕШЕНО]
glebiuskv 10 июля, 2013 - 14:00День добрый. Поставил Redmine.
www-apps/redmine
Installed versions: 2.2.4(03:12:31 10.07.2013)(ldap ruby_targets_ruby18 ruby_targets_ruby19 -elibc_FreeBSD -fastcgi -imagemagick -openid -passenger -test)
При заходе с локального компа на 127.0.0.1:3000 все нормально но если попытаться зайти с удаленного компа то выдает 404-ю.
Остановка сервиса iptables не помогает.
Перенес на порт 8064 тоже не помогло.
На сервере работает томкат, и еще пара задач слушающих порты. Никаких проблем с ними не испытываю.
[РЕШЕНИЕ]
Установка Communigate
kosenka 10 июля, 2013 - 10:35Добрый день.
Хочу установить Communigate.
Устанавливаю его по этой статье: http://gnu.su/news.php?extend.96
При установке вываливается ошибка:
************************
* IMPORTANT: 1 news items need reading for repository 'gentoo'.
* Use eselect news to read news items.
* Last emerge --sync was Wed Sep 7 21:05:01 2011.
These are the packages that would be merged, in order:
Calculating dependencies... done!
[ebuild N ] app-arch/rpm2targz-9.0.0.4g 5 kB
[ebuild N ] mail-mta/communigate-5.2.5 USE="-doc -mailwrapper" 17,837 kB
Проблемы с сервером [Solved]
fame 9 июля, 2013 - 16:46Так, господа ребята, сегодня случилось кое что для меня ужасное и мне нужна Ваша помощь.
Проверял с утра машину, смотрю что не работают не одна команда, ни emerge, ls, top ничего... После как запросил kvm, оказалось что raid контроллер был offline
http://rghost.ru/47312616
http://rghost.ru/47312631
(так в сервере ссд на систему и 2 харда на папку /home и /usr) так же при загрузке системи было "No logical drive found". Так вот в чем проблема, после того как запустили силой raid (force online) и перевелось в статус оптимал. После ребута все практически востановилось кроме /home
[code]
tcpdump, собранный в gentoo приводит к ребуту
mittorn 9 июля, 2013 - 01:23Собрал tcpdump на armv6j через portage, при запуске на одном из интерфейсов он перезагружает систему мгновенно. Платформа - телефон samsung на android. Сначала думал, что ядро так реагирует на захват пакетов, скачал какой-то шарк с google play, а в нём бинарник tcpdump, работающий стабильно. Собрал tcpdump, отключив всё, что можно, но ребут всё равно происходит. Куда копать?
Перестало рабротать разрешение имён после установки layman с зависимостями.[решено]
mittorn 8 июля, 2013 - 10:12Установил layman на свежераспакованную систему, что подхватило кучу зависимостей. После завершения emerge обнаружил, что все попытки доступа в сеть по именам завершаются с ошибкой. Причём, система в chroot и на хосте всё нормально работает, а на gentoo даже в сеть лезть не пытается. busybox'овский nslookup говорит, что сервер 127.0.0.1, хотя прописан 8.8.8.8. Сам 8.8.8.8 пингуется в gentoo, а если указать nslookup другой сервер, всё равно не работает.
Куда копать?
Использовал stage3 armv6j_hardfloat.
Оказалось, что неправильно назван resolv.conf
Не собирается glibc 2.17
Antonio 7 июля, 2013 - 17:54http://www.gentoo.ru/node/27098 - проблема описана тут, но человек решил не делиться решением... Имею аналогичную проблему. Помогите решить. Спасибо!
Настройка iptables
Drakon 5 июля, 2013 - 19:17Сделал в iptables запрет всех входящих пакетов, кроме TCP на 80 порт и ещё некоторых, но в логи всё равно сыпятся ошибки про непропущенные TCP-пакеты на 80 порт. В чём может быть дело?
Правила iptables
iptables -P INPUT DROP iptables -P FORWARD DROP iptables -P OUTPUT DROP iptables -A INPUT -d 9.9.9.9 -i eth3 -p tcp --dport 80 -m conntrack --ctstate NEW,ESTABLISHED -j ACCEPT iptables -A OUTPUT -s 9.9.9.9 -o eth3 -p tcp --sport 80 -m conntrack --ctstate ESTABLISHED -j ACCEPT
tail /var/log/kern.log
[code]
- « первая
- ‹ предыдущая
- …
- 50
- 51
- 52
- 53
- 54
- 55
- 56
- 57
- 58
- …
- следующая ›
- последняя »
